Texas Democrats urge Gov. Greg Abbott to direct emergency funds to address the looming SNAP crisis
Democrats argue Gov. Abbott has used his authority during COVID-19, the Uvalde shooting and border operations to free up emergency funds.
The calls to the Republican governor came as the food stamp program was set to run out of funding amid the government shutdown.

Dallas County Judge raises over $2 million to tide over SNAP lapse
The money will go to the North Texas Food Bank and food boxes for furloughed federal workers and for Dallas County residents who are right now without SNAP benefits and for now will get less than what they normally receive.
